Output 38ab85311810c90793ecaf180a2dd96e8a241b55bc1992d0e4bd3b8b743226ab:0

value
6384064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475eca99eb92c6180203b56c40cc2896eba97736 OP_EQUAL
address
38CPTPNBXuXLpnJYpGe8LJ79uY1A1FvaeN
transaction
38ab85311810c90793ecaf180a2dd96e8a241b55bc1992d0e4bd3b8b743226ab
spent
true